Today well be going over how to create and import Print Mode Packages in the Color Byte RIP software. Creating a print mode package will allow you to save any custom print modes you may have. It is a good idea to back up any custom print modes in the even that you need to reinstall the software. Lets start by creating a print mode package. In the RIP, lets go to the top, click on devices, Manage print modes. This will bring up a list of all the current print modes for the specified device. If you do not see your custom print modes, you can click on the drop down menu here to select the device in which those print modes were created. Im going to choose the DCS 1800s IR2. You can select the printmodes you would like to save by holding down the control key on your keyboard. This will allow you to select multiple print modes.
